Hydrogen Production Using Coal Gasification The process most likely to be used for turning coal into hydrogen is called gasifi cation. Coal gasifi cation dates back to the mid 19th century when it was used to make "town gas" for local cooking, heating, and lighting—many of the uses that natural gas meets today. The figure of gasification reactions and transformations illustrated the concept of coal gasification, and noted resulting composition of syngas. This can vary significantly depending on the feedstock and the gasification process involved; however typically syngas is 30 to 60% carbon monoxide (CO), 25 to 30% hydrogen (H 2), 0 to 5% methane (CH 4), 5 to 15% carbon dioxide (CO 2), plus a lesser ...

The selected production process is typically based on a number of the following factors: types of available, cost of feedstocks, and the desired syngas product composition. The syngas composition is commonly referred to in terms of H2/CO ratio, which is simply the moles of hydrogen divided by the moles of carbon monoxide.

Coal gasification is the process of converting coal into synthesis gas (also called syngas), which is a mixture of hydrogen (H2), carbon monoxide (CO) and carbon dioxide (CO2). The syngas can be used in a variety of applications such as in the production of electricity and making chemical products, such as fertilisers.

1 Introduction. Synthesis gas (syngas) production is the cornerstone of many industries. This H2 /CO mixture is mainly produced from gasification (coal, heavy hydrocarbons) or reforming (light hydrocarbons). Steam, oxygen, carbon dioxide or mixtures of them act as reforming agents and react with the carbon source at high temperatures.

Based on this earlier discovery, the Badische Anilin und Soda Fabrik (BASF) patented a syngasbased methanol production process, where syngas was supplied via coal gasification. This process required a zinc/chromium oxide catalyst as well as high temperature and pressure (300400 °C and 250350 atm).

The Cocatalyzed process is typically chosen for maximum wax production in LTFT gas to liquid (GTL) processes; however, the use of ironbased catalysts is generally preferred for CTL because coalderived syngas is deficient in H 2 and cobalt does not catalyze the WGSR that supplements H 2 production during the ironcatalyzed FT reaction. In industrial chemistry, coal gasification is the process of producing syngas —a mixture consisting primarily of carbon monoxide (CO), hydrogen ( H2 ), carbon dioxide ( CO2 ), methane ( CH4 ), and water vapour ( H2O )—from coal and water, air and/or oxygen. Historically, coal was gasified to produce coal gas, also known as "town gas".

The term Syngas is used for describing a mixture containing H2 and CO, together with minor amounts of CO2 and CH4. Syngas can be produced from Natural Gas (NG), refinery offgases, naphtha, heavy hydrocarbons and also from coal. Steam reforming or steam methane reforming (SMR) is a method for producing syngas (hydrogen and carbon monoxide) by reaction of hydrocarbons with water. Commonly natural gas is the feedstock. syngas, mixture of primarily hydrogen and carbon monoxide that often also contains some amount of carbon dioxide and methane and that is highly combustible.
